Reports and timeframes

Functional Capacity Assessment reports commonly take approximately one to three months.

An urgent timeframe of approximately two weeks may sometimes be possible, depending on complexity, available information, access to relevant people and current capacity.

Appointments

Home, community and telehealth appointments may be considered case by case where suitable.

Funding and referral arrangements are considered individually and confirmed before services begin.
